Quality of Operations


Lupin's operational quality remains a strong pillar supporting its revised evaluation. The company maintains a low average debt-to-equity ratio of 0.10 times, indicating prudent financial management and limited reliance on debt financing. This conservative capital structure reduces financial risk and enhances stability.


Moreover, Lupin has demonstrated consistent long-term growth, with net sales expanding at an annual rate of 10.57%. Operating profit margins have also shown resilience, registering a growth rate of 37.09%. These figures suggest effective cost management and operational efficiency, which are critical for sustaining profitability in the competitive pharmaceutical industry.

Valuation Perspective


From a valuation standpoint, Lupin presents an appealing profile. The company’s price-to-book value stands at 4.9, which is considered attractive relative to its sector peers. This valuation is supported by a return on equity (ROE) of 22%, signalling efficient utilisation of shareholder funds to generate profits.


Additionally, Lupin’s stock trades at a discount compared to the average historical valuations of its pharmaceutical peers. This relative undervaluation may offer investors a favourable entry point, especially given the company’s solid fundamentals and growth prospects.



Financial Trend Analysis


The financial trend for Lupin reveals encouraging developments. The company’s profit before tax excluding other income for the quarter ending September 2025 was ₹1,916.97 crores, reflecting a growth rate of 82.3% compared to the previous four-quarter average. This substantial increase highlights Lupin’s improving profitability and operational leverage.


Return on capital employed (ROCE) for the half-year period reached a peak of 22.22%, underscoring effective capital utilisation. Furthermore, the operating profit to interest ratio for the quarter was recorded at 21.76 times, indicating strong coverage of interest expenses and financial robustness.



Technical Market Signals


On the technical front, Lupin’s stock exhibits bullish characteristics. The recent price movements show positive momentum, with a one-day gain of 1.19% and a one-week increase of 2.90%. Over the past six months, the stock has appreciated by 8.81%, reflecting sustained investor interest and confidence.


Despite a year-to-date return of -10.05%, the stock’s one-year return stands at 3.45%, suggesting recovery and resilience in the face of broader market fluctuations. These technical indicators complement the fundamental strengths, reinforcing the stock’s overall appeal.
